What is Sustainable Development?

Sustainable development is development which meets the


needs of the present without compromising the ability of
future generation to meet their own needs.

This definition has
been formulated by
the World
Commission on
Environment and
Development
(WCED), led by the
norwegian prime
minister Gro Harlem
Brundtland, in 1987.

Sustainable construction is defined as "the creation
and responsible management of a healthy built
environment based on resource efficient and
ecological principles".

Sustainably designed buildings
aim to lessen their impact on our
environment through energy
and resource efficiency.

It includes the following


principles:
Minimizing non-renewable resource
consumption

Enhancing the natural environment
Eliminating or
minimizing the
use of toxins
